WebOct 3, 2024 · Intramuscular hematoma most commonly occurs following trauma; however, spontaneous hematomas may be seen in elderly patients due to anticoagulation. Intramuscular hematomas may not be chronically expanding, and their signs and symptoms vary, ranging from asymptomatic to swelling that may be expanding in size. WebA hematoma, also spelled haematoma, or blood suffusion is a localized bleeding outside of blood vessels, due to either disease or trauma including injury or surgery [1] and may involve blood continuing to seep from broken capillaries. A hematoma is benign and is initially in liquid form spread among the tissues including in sacs between tissues ... WebA subdural haematoma is a serious condition where blood collects between the skull and the surface of the brain. It's usually caused by a head injury. Symptoms of a subdural haematoma can include: a headache that keeps getting worse feeling and being sick confusion personality changes, such as being unusually aggressive or having rapid mood …

WebSubungual haemorrhage is a clinical diagnosis supported by dermoscopy. The dermoscopic features of subungual haemorrhage can include [2–4]: Homogeneous or variable colours (reddish, purple, brown, or black) Peripheral globular structures (also called clods) and streaks. Transmission occurs directly through close contact with an infected individual or indirectly via contaminated objects such as toys, clothing, or towels. fly from providence to orlandoWebNov 1, 2024 · How can I tell if a wound is infected? A wound which has become, or is becoming, infected may: Become more painful, instead of gradually improving. Look red around the skin edges. This red area may feel warm or hot. Look swollen.
